The Northwest Rail commuter rail line scheduled to open to the public in early 2015 will link RTDs rail system from downtown Denver, through the Northwestern suburbs to Boulder, and on to Longmont. The project will be a 42-mile diesel commuter rail line from Denver Union Station to downtown Longmont, serving Denver, Westminster, Broomfield, Louisville, Boulder and Longmont.
